This electrical power engineering degree programme has been designed in collaboration with the industry and has a strong emphasis on practical experience.
Year 1: Core modules; engineering computing; fundamentals of electrical engineering; professional orientation practice 1; mechanical principles A; engineering materials; mathematics 1; mechanical principles B; engineering applications. Year 2: Core modules; analogue electronics; digital electronics; engineering design and analysis 2; mathematics 2; professional orientation and practice 2; control and instrumentation systems; energy resources; generation and utilisation; electrical systems. Year 3: Core modules; control engineering 3; power electronic systems 3; plant and electrical distributon; energy conversion technologies; professional orientation and practice 3; industrial practice. Year 4: Core modules; project; power systems technology; electrical machines; renewable energy technology; control engineering 4.
